Background technique
In delivery industry, in order to solve the problems, such as that courier send part, pickup difficult, express mail is arranged in residential communities in express company Cabinet, for temporarily storing express mail, express mail is stored in express mail cabinet, is voluntarily taken away by user by courier, alternatively, user will need The express mail of mailing is stored in express mail cabinet, is taken away by courier.
The multiple storage chambers of setting in the cabinet body of the express mail cabinet provided in the related technology, multiple storage chambers are arranged in M row N column, The open-mouth of each storage chamber is provided with the cabinet door for closing or opening wide the opening, is also set up between each cabinet door and cabinet body There is the safety lock for locking cabinet door position, since storage chamber is cube structure, there is the length of setting, each storage Chamber can only store an express mail, and the express mail relatively thin for letter etc. greatly wastes the space in storage chamber, therefore this fast Part cabinet has that space utilization rate is low.
The relevant technologies additionally provide a kind of revolving express mail cabinet and are able to solve the low problem of space utilization rate, this express mail It is provided with rotatable rotating disk mechanism in the storage chamber of cabinet, rotating disk mechanism includes shaft and is sequentially arranged at and turns along the circumferential direction of shaft Multiple lattices on axis form an express mail memory block between two neighboring lattice.This rotary express mail cabinet by Rotating disk mechanism is set in the storage chamber of express mail cabinet, a storage chamber is separated into the multiple express mails storage being circumferentially arranged along shaft Area may be implemented a storage chamber while store multiple express mails, therefore, greatly improves the space utilization rate of express mail cabinet;But It is that the rotating disk mechanism of this rotary express mail cabinet is complicated, and control is cumbersome, is unfavorable for production assembly and uses.

Fig. 1 is the structural schematic diagram of intelligent express mail cabinet 010 in the utility model embodiment;Fig. 2 is the utility model implementation The structural schematic diagram of storing mechanism 200 in example;Fig. 3 is that the partial structurtes of intelligent express mail cabinet 010 in the utility model embodiment are shown It is intended to;Fig. 1 to Fig. 3 is please referred to, the present embodiment provides a kind of intelligent express mail cabinets 010 comprising cabinet body 100,200 and of storing mechanism Unlocking mechanism 300, wherein storing mechanism 200 and unlocking mechanism 300 are set to cabinet body 100, and storing mechanism 200 includes multiple edges The storage chamber 210 of preset direction distribution, and each storage chamber 210 can be used in storing an express mails such as letter, each storage Chamber 210 is provided with the opening for picking and placing express mail, the baffle 221 for closing or opening opening and locking assembly, and (figure is not Show), when baffle 221 closes opening, locking assembly is configured as the closed position of locked flapper 221;Above-mentioned unlocking mechanism 300 Lock set 320 is conciliate including driving assembly 310, driving assembly 310 is set to cabinet body 100, solves lock set 320 and driving assembly 310 transmission connections, under the driving of driving assembly 310, solution lock set 320 is configured as to move along preset direction, alternatively The closed position locking of any one baffle 221 is released, so that baffle 221 can open opening, i.e., driving assembly 310 is able to drive The preset direction that lock set 320 is solved in storing mechanism 200 is mobile, when to be moved to a baffle 221 corresponding for solution lock set 320 Behind position, the position locking of the baffle 221 of corresponding position can be released, so as to which the opening of the storage chamber 210 is opened wide.It needs Bright, the preset direction in the present embodiment refers to the left and right directions of cabinet body 100, i.e., multiple storage chambers 210 are divided in left-right direction Cloth, driving assembly 310 can drive solution lock set 320 to move in left-right direction;Optionally, in other embodiments, side is preset To the up and down direction that can also refer to cabinet body 100, i.e., multiple storage chambers 210 are being distributed along the vertical direction, and driving assembly 310 can drive Dynamic solution lock set 320 moves along the vertical direction.
Referring to figure 2., in detail, the storing mechanism 200 in the present embodiment includes top plate 201 and lower plywood 202, above-mentioned Multiple storage chambers 210 are set between top plate 201 and lower plywood 202, are successively arranged in left-right direction, above-mentioned unlocking mechanism 300 are set to lower plywood 202;Optionally, in other embodiments, unlocking mechanism 300 can also be set to top plate 201, or For person in the embodiment that storage chamber 210 is distributed along the vertical direction, storing mechanism 200 includes left plate and right side plate, multiple storages Chamber 210 is set between left plate and right side plate, is successively arranged along the vertical direction, and unlocking mechanism 300 can also be set to storage The left plate or right side plate of mechanism 200.Further, in this embodiment storing mechanism 200 further include multiple lattices 203, multiple lattices 203 are all set between top plate 201 and lower plywood 202, and shape between two adjacent lattices 203 At a storage chamber 210.
The storing mechanism 200 of the present embodiment further includes rotation axis 222, and the first end of baffle 221 passes through rotation axis 222 and deposits Storage chamber 210 is rotatablely connected, and the quantity of baffle 221 is equal with the quantity of storage chamber 210, and position corresponds, each storage chamber 210 open by a closure of baffle 221 or is opened, when axis rotation of the baffle 221 around rotation axis 222, closing or Open the opening of the storage chamber 210.In detail, the quantity of the rotation axis 222 in the present embodiment is identical with the quantity of baffle 221, That is each storage chamber 210 is arranged a rotation axis 222, and the both ends of the rotation axis 222 in the present embodiment respectively with storage chamber 210 Mounting hole 204 (as shown in Figure 9) grafting of two 203 upper ends of lattice of two sides, baffle 221 can be around the axis of rotation axis 222 Relative to the rotation of storage chamber 210, the opening of open closed position and opening storage chamber 210 with enclosed storage chamber 210 Open position;Optionally, in other embodiments, rotation axis 222 is rotatablely arranged at storage chamber 210, baffle 221 and rotation Axis 222 is fixedly connected;Optionally, in other embodiments, the quantity of rotation axis 222 can be one, 222 energy of rotation axis Enough run through entire storing mechanism 200, i.e., rotation axis 222 can be throughout whole storage chambers 210, and rotation axis 222 and whole Storage chamber 210 is fixedly connected, and each baffle 221 is rotatably coupled with rotation axis 222.
Referring to figure 3., further, the storing mechanism 200 of the present embodiment further includes the first elastic component 223, the first elasticity Part 223 is connected between baffle 221 and storage chamber 210, and the first elastic component 223 is configured as making baffle 221 to have always turning It moves to the movement tendency of open position.
Still further, the first elastic component 223 in the present embodiment is torsional spring, the quantity of torsional spring and the quantity of baffle 221 Unanimously, i.e., the baffle 221 of each storage chamber 210 configures a torsional spring, and torsion spring set is set in above-mentioned rotation axis 222, and torsional spring First end abutted with storage chamber 210 namely the first end of torsional spring can be abutted with the top plate 201 of storing mechanism 200, torsional spring Second end abutted with baffle 221, which is configured as making baffle 221 always and has to turn to open position to open wide storage The movement tendency of chamber 210, i.e., baffle 221 not by addition to torsional spring provide power other than other external force when, torsional spring can promote It rotates baffle 221 and opens wide storage chamber 210, the opening of storage chamber 210 is opened wide.Optionally, in other embodiments, the first bullet Property part 223 can also be the elastic component of the other forms such as spring.
Fig. 4 is the structural schematic diagram of storing mechanism 200 and unlocking mechanism 300 in the utility model embodiment;Fig. 5 is Fig. 4 The cross-sectional view in the middle direction A-A;Fig. 6 is the enlarged drawing in Fig. 5 at VI;Locking assembly referring to figure 4. to Fig. 6, in the present embodiment Including latch hook 224 and chuck 225, chuck 225 is set to the open corresponding position of storage chamber 210, and latch hook 224 is rotationally It is set to the second end of the separate first end of baffle 221, when baffle 221 is located at closed position, latch hook 224 and chuck 225 are blocked Cooperation is connect, baffle 221 is locked on the open closed position of closing;In detail, chuck 225 is set to lower plywood 202, latch hook 224 are set to the one end of baffle 221 far from rotation axis 222, when open closing of the baffle 221 by storage chamber 210, are set to gear The latch hook 224 of 221 lower end of plate can be engaged by clamping with the chuck 225 of lower plywood 202, so as to utilize latch hook 224 and chuck 225 are locked in baffle 221 the open closed position of enclosed storage chamber 210;When latch hook 224 to the direction far from chuck 225 After movement, latch hook 224 can be separated with chuck 225, and under the action of the first elastic component 223, baffle 221 can turn to opening The opening of storage chamber 210 is opened in position.
Further, referring to figure 3., the locking assembly of the present embodiment further includes the second elastic component 227, the second elastic component 227 first end is connect with baffle 221, and the second end of the second elastic component 227 is connect with latch hook 224, and the second elastic component 227 is matched It is set to, makes latch hook 224 that there is the movement tendency being engaged by clamping with chuck 225 always when baffle 221 is located at closed position;Work as When baffle 221 is located at closed position, the second elastic component 227 can make latch hook 224 not influenced to protect always by other active forces The state being clamped with chuck 225 is held, to improve stability when latch hook 224 and the clamping of chuck 225.Second in the present embodiment Elastic component 227 is latch plate, and the first end of latch plate is connect with baffle 221, and the second end of latch plate is connect with latch hook 224;It can Choosing, in other embodiments, the second elastic component 227 can also be spring, torsional spring etc..
Referring to figure 3., the driving assembly 310 of the present embodiment includes first motor 311, conveyer belt 312 and two transmission wheels 313, first motor 311 is set to cabinet body 100, and two transmission wheels 313 are arranged along preset direction interval, one of transmission wheel 313 connect with first motor 311, and are driven by first motor 311, and conveyer belt 312 is set to two transmission wheels 313 and by two Transmission wheel 313 supports, and above-mentioned solution lock set 320 is fixedly connected with conveyer belt 312;In detail, the first motor in the present embodiment 311 setting lower plywoods 202;When first motor 311 is started to work, first motor 311 is able to drive transmission wheel connected to it 313 rotate together, and the transmission wheel 313 connecting with first motor 311 is able to drive conveyer belt 312 and another transmission wheel 313 1 And rotate, conveyer belt 312 drives solution lock set 320 to move along preset direction.
Optionally, in other embodiments, driving assembly 310 can also include motor, conveyer chain and two sprocket wheels, motor It is set to lower plywood 202, two sprocket wheels are arranged along the preset direction interval of storing mechanism 200, and one of sprocket wheel connects in motor It connects, and rotation is driven by motor, conveyer chain is set to two sprocket wheels and is supported by two sprocket wheels.
Referring to figure 3., the solution lock set 320 of the present embodiment includes support frame 321 and unlock piece 330, and unlock piece 330 is arranged In support frame 321, unlock piece 330 is configured as releasing the position locking for the baffle 221 for being located at closed position, so that baffle 221 Open position can be turned to, to open the opening of storage chamber 210;In detail, support frame 321 and conveyer belt in the present embodiment 312 are fixedly connected, and support frame 321 can be moved with the transmission of conveyer belt 312, are set to the unlock piece 330 of support frame 321 Can be mobile with support frame 321, i.e., first motor 311 can drive conveyer belt 312 to drive support frame 321 and be set to support The unlock piece 330 of frame 321 is mobile, and unlock piece 330 can traverse each storage chamber 210 of storing mechanism 200, work as support frame When unlock piece 330 on 321 is opposite with the baffle 221 of one of storage chamber 210, unlock piece 330 can release the baffle 221 Closed position position locking, then baffle 221 can turn to open position under the action of the first elastic component 223, will The open of storage chamber 210 is opened.
Preferably, the lower plywood 202 of the storing mechanism 200 of the present embodiment is additionally provided with guide rail 314, and guide rail 314 is along default Direction extends, and support frame 321 is provided with sliding slot, and guide rail 314 can be embedded in sliding slot, and support frame 321 is in driving assembly 310 Driving effect under, along guide rail 314 slide, so, the movement of support frame 321 can be made more stable.
Preferably, Fig. 9 is please referred to, the bottom of each storage chamber 210 of the present embodiment is provided with limited step 226, limit Position step 226 is located at close to the open position of storage chamber 210, and limited step 226 is used to limit the closed position of baffle 221, Baffle 221 is avoided to enter the inside of storage chamber 210.
Optionally, in other embodiments, driving assembly 310 can also include motor, lead screw and nut, and motor is set to The transmission axis connection of the lower plywood 202 of storing mechanism 200, lead screw and motor, and lead screw prolongs along the preset direction of storing mechanism 200 It stretches, above-mentioned nut is connect with lead screw transmission, i.e., when lead screw rotates under the drive of the motor, nut can be on lead screw along storage The preset direction of mechanism 200 slides, and further, the support frame 321 of unlock piece 330 is fixedly connected with nut, i.e., using drive Dynamic component 310 drives unlock piece 330 mobile in the preset direction of storage organization.
Referring to figure 3., further, the unlock piece 330 of the present embodiment includes the second motor 331 and cam 332, the second electricity Machine 331 is set to above-mentioned support frame 321, the output axis connection of cam 332 and the second motor 331, and cam 332 and is configured as turning The position locking of the baffle 221 positioned at closed position can be released when dynamic;In detail, when unlock piece 330 is moved to corresponding one Storage chamber 210 opens the second motor 331, and the second motor 331 is rotated with moving cam 332, when cam 332 and is set to baffle 221 When the latch hook 224 of second end abuts, cam 332 can jack up latch hook 224 to the direction far from chuck 225, so that lock Hook 224 separates (referring to figure 4., Fig. 7 and Fig. 8) with the chuck 225 of lower plywood 202, work of the baffle 221 in the first elastic component 223 With lower rotating opening storage chamber 210, then complete the process for baffle 221 being unlocked using unlock piece 330.
Optionally, in other embodiments, unlock piece 330 includes electromagnet (not shown), and electromagnet is configured as leading to The position locking of the baffle 221 positioned at closed position can be released when electricity or power-off;In detail, electromagnet include coil, iron core, Armature and spring;Coil is arranged and iron core, and one end of spring pocket is connect with armature, and the other end is connect with support frame 321, works as electromagnetism When Tie Tong electricity, armature overcomes the elastic force of spring to stretch out under the attraction of iron core, and latch hook 224 can be driven to separate with chuck 225, when When electromagnet powers off, iron core retracts under the action of the spring, and iron core is separated with latch hook 224.When unlock piece 330 is with conveyer belt 312 when being moved to the position of storage chamber 210 to be opened, and the electromagnet of unlock piece 330 is powered, and armature, which stretches out, drives corresponding gear The latch hook 224 of 221 lower end of plate is separated with chuck 225, reaches the position purpose of unlock baffle 221.It should be noted that at other In embodiment, when being also possible to electromagnet energization, armature overcomes the elastic force of spring to retract, and when electromagnet powers off, armature is in bullet It is stretched out under the action of spring, driving latch hook 224 is separated with chuck 225.
The working principle of intelligent express mail cabinet 010 is: multiple storage chambers that storing mechanism 200 is set gradually along preset direction 210 can use the express mails such as storage letter, and when letter is stored in storage chamber 210, the baffle 221 for being set to storage chamber 210 can Closed position is moved to, and the latch hook 224 of 221 lower end of baffle setting can be engaged by clamping with the chuck 225 of lower plywood 202, from And baffle 221 is locked in closed position, the opening of storage chamber 210 is closed, it can letter is stored in storage chamber 210 In;When needing to take out the letter in storage chamber 210 or the placement letter into storage chamber 210, first motor 311 is utilized to drive Unlock piece 330 is moved to the position of corresponding storage chamber 210, is then rotated, is utilized using the second motor 331 control cam 332 Cam 332 lifts latch hook 224 far from the direction of chuck 225, in order to separate latch hook 224 with chuck 225, releases the baffle 221 position locking, the baffle 221 after unlock can turn to open position under the action of the first elastic component 223, will store The opening of chamber 210 is opened wide, convenient for taking out the letter in storage chamber 210 or the express mails such as placement letter into storage chamber 210.
